Khomchenkova, Irina A. "Conditional and concessive constructions with Russian conjunctions esli ‘if’ and xotja ‘although’ in Hill Mari speech." Voprosy Jazykoznanija, no. 5 (November 1, 2024): 116–34. http://dx.doi.org/10.31857/0373-658x.2024.5.116-134.

Full text
Abstract:
In Hill Mari speech, there are both native conjunctions (for example, gə̈n’(ə̈) ‘if’, gə̈n’ät ‘although’) and borrowed Russian conjunctions (for example, esli ‘if’, xotja ‘although’). I examined the structure of conditional and concessive clauses in Hill Mari and compared them with the Russian ones. Structurally, these constructions are similar in Russian and Hill Mari (finite verbs, presence of a conjunction), only the position of the conjunction differs. LI, Luxia. "On the formation of concessive conjunctions RAN and RAN'ER." Cahiers de Linguistique Asie Orientale 39, no. 2 (2010): 213–47. http://dx.doi.org/10.1163/1960602810x00034.

Full text
Abstract:
Contrary to many Chinese linguists who regard the historical development of the conjunctions rán and rán'ér as identical, I argue that the two are in fact distinct. Through a thorough analysis of occurrences of these conjunctions in twelve texts from the Archaic and Mediaeval Chinese periods, I show that ran, originally a verbal demonstrative occurring between clauses that are not semantically coherent, grammaticalized into a conjunction under the influence of the context. Bott, Lewis, Steven Frisson, and Gregory L. Murphy. "Interpreting conjunctions." Quarterly Journal of Experimental Psychology 62, no. 4 (2009): 681–706. http://dx.doi.org/10.1080/17470210802214866.

Full text
Abstract:
The interpretation generated from a sentence of the form P and Q can often be different to that generated by Q and P, despite the fact that and has a symmetric truth-conditional meaning. We experimentally investigated to what extent this difference in meaning is due to the connective and and to what extent it is due to order of mention of the events in the sentence.
